Kanchi Karpooram Limited (BOM:538896)
India flag India · Delayed Price · Currency is INR
345.20
-6.30 (-1.79%)
At close: Feb 12, 2026

Kanchi Karpooram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
1,4981,6191,5421,6572,9753,663
Market Cap Growth
-21.86%5.03%-6.95%-44.31%-18.78%393.64%
Enterprise Value
1,2061,1771,1371,4092,1633,126
Last Close Price
344.85371.91353.61379.11677.87826.35
PE Ratio
28.9811.80258.1012.349.705.84
PS Ratio
1.051.071.060.751.191.99
PB Ratio
0.700.770.790.841.612.35
P/TBV Ratio
0.700.770.780.841.612.35
P/FCF Ratio
--6.09-42.3810.24
P/OCF Ratio
-21.204.4910.6924.868.22
EV/Sales Ratio
0.850.780.780.640.861.70
EV/EBITDA Ratio
15.696.5581.907.285.013.85
EV/EBIT Ratio
33.708.12-8.505.273.91
EV/FCF Ratio
--4.49-30.818.74
Debt / Equity Ratio
0.070.000.000.000.010.01
Debt / EBITDA Ratio
1.790.030.330.030.020.01
Debt / FCF Ratio
--0.02-0.140.03
Net Debt / Equity Ratio
-0.14-0.24-0.24-0.11-0.13-0.39
Net Debt / EBITDA Ratio
-3.83-2.83-34.71-1.10-0.57-0.75
Net Debt / FCF Ratio
-81.74-1.904.05-3.54-1.70
Asset Turnover
-0.720.711.111.361.34
Inventory Turnover
-1.591.612.633.641.98
Quick Ratio
-11.4010.368.607.073.82
Current Ratio
-23.6720.5725.3414.006.85
Return on Equity (ROE)
-6.51%-0.11%6.71%17.99%50.40%
Return on Assets (ROA)
-4.30%-0.41%5.21%13.83%36.34%
Return on Invested Capital (ROIC)
1.44%6.84%0.28%7.09%23.11%73.54%
Return on Capital Employed (ROCE)
-6.90%-0.70%8.30%22.00%50.80%
Earnings Yield
3.45%8.48%0.39%8.10%10.31%17.11%
FCF Yield
--0.38%16.41%-3.17%2.36%9.77%
Dividend Yield
0.29%0.27%0.28%0.26%0.37%0.48%
Payout Ratio
-3.16%72.72%8.45%5.66%0.70%
Buyback Yield / Dilution
----0.38%0.09%
Total Shareholder Return
0.29%0.27%0.28%0.26%0.75%0.58%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.